Questions about an official Edwards County criminal record must go to the public office that holds it. The combined clerk handles filed county and district court cases, while the sheriff is the first local contact for sheriff reports and custody routing. Texas DPS maintains the statewide repository. Need an Official Record?

Use the office that created or maintains the requested Edwards County record:

  • Court case files: use the Edwards County criminal court case route or call the combined County and District Clerk at 830-683-2235
  • Arrest, booking, and jail records: call the Edwards County Sheriff at 830-683-4104
  • Police and incident reports: request the record from the agency named on the report or citation
  • Criminal-history repository records: contact the Texas Department of Public Safety Crime Records Division
  • Official personal record review: follow the Texas DPS fingerprint-review process through FAST and IdentoGO
  • Expunction and nondisclosure filings: confirm the correct court and local requirements with the combined clerk

The Edwards County Sheriff's Office is at 404 W. Austin, Rocksprings, TX 78880, with mail to P.O. Box 156. Its 24-hour non-emergency number is 830-683-4104, the main office is 830-683-8305, and published public hours are Monday through Friday, 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. Court records are held by the combined County and District Clerk at 101 E. Main, P.O. Box 184, Rocksprings, TX 78880; phone 830-683-2235 and fax 830-683-5376.
